How to Connect Arlo Doorbell to WiFi:

Here is a complete, step-by-step guide that will help you connect Arlo doorbell to your WiFi network.

  • Download the Arlo App: First things first, you need to download the Arlo app on your smartphone. This app will guide you on how to connect Arlo doorbell to WiFi.
  • Set up an Arlo Account: If you’re new to Arlo, you’ll need to set up an account. For existing users, simply log in.how to connect arlo doorbell to wifi
  • Add a New Device: Once you’re logged in, select the option related to add a new device to connect Arlo doorbell to your account.
  • Select Your Doorbell: Choose the type of doorbell you’re trying to connect from the list of Arlo devices. This is an essential step in the process of how to connect Arlo doorbell to WiFi.
  • Follow the On-screen Instructions: The Arlo app will provide you with on-screen instructions to complete the setup. Follow these carefully to connect Arlo doorbell to your WiFi network.
  • Test the Connection: Once you have completed the setup process, test the doorbell to ensure it’s connected correctly.

Causes of Arlo Doorbell Not Connecting to WiFi:

If your Arlo doorbell won’t connect to WiFi there could be various reasons behind it. Understanding these reasons can help you troubleshoot effectively. Let’s explore some common issues:

  • Weak WiFi Signal: One of the most common reasons why your Arlo doorbell won’t connect to WiFi is a weak or unstable WiFi signal. If your Arlo doorbell is too far from your router, it might not receive a strong enough signal to establish a connection.arlo doorbell not connecting to wifi
  • Incorrect WiFi Password: If the WiFi password entered during the setup process is incorrect, your Arlo video doorbell won’t connect to WiFi.
  • Software Glitch: Occasionally, a temporary software glitch could be the reason your Arlo doorbell won’t connect to WiFi.
  • Outdated Firmware: If your device’s firmware isn’t up to date, it can cause issues like your Arlo video doorbell won’t connect to WiFi.
  • Network Congestion: If too many devices are linked to your WiFi network, it might not be able to handle the additional load of the Arlo doorbell, causing connection issues.

How to Fix Arlo Doorbell Not Connecting to WiFi

Experiencing an Arlo doorbell not connecting to WiFi can be a significant inconvenience. However, rest assured that this is usually solvable. Here are the steps you can take to resolve these connection issues:

  • Check WiFi Connection: If your Arlo doorbell not connecting to WiFi, the first thing to check is your WiFi connection. Make sure that your WiFi is functioning correctly and that the signal strength is adequate where your doorbell is installed.arlo doorbell won't connect to wifi
  • Verify the WiFi Password: An incorrect WiFi password can cause your Arlo doorbell not connecting to WiFi. Ensure you’ve entered the correct WiFi password during the setup process.
  • Reboot Your Doorbell and Router: Sometimes, a simple reboot can fix the issue of your Arlo doorbell not connecting to WiFi. Try to reboot both your doorbell and your router and then attempt to reconnect.
  • Update Firmware: If your Arlo doorbell not connecting to WiFi, it could be due to outdated firmware. Regularly check and update your doorbell’s firmware to ensure it’s running on the latest version.
  • Reduce WiFi Traffic: If there are too many devices connected to your WiFi network, it could potentially lead to your Arlo doorbell not connecting to WiFi. Try disconnecting unnecessary devices from your network and then attempt to connect your doorbell again.
